Shows swagger yaml/json rendered by Swagger-UI. This extension replace swagger code into preview html in GitHub.
# ⚠️Sorry! No longer supported.⚠️
Dear Community,
Due to time constraints, I'm archiving the swagger-viewer repository and ending support. Grateful for all contributions, please feel free to fork and continue the project. Thank you for your understanding.
---
Works completely offline.
## Demo
### Easy to convert
https://raw.githubusercontent.com/arx-8/swagger-viewer/main/README-Demo_1.gif
### Easy to expand / collapse
https://raw.githubusercontent.com/arx-8/swagger-viewer/main/README-Demo_2.gif
## Spec.
- Supported sites.
- GitHub
- Supported OpenAPI ver.
- 2.0
- 3.0
- Supported file ext.
- yaml
- yml
- json
## Usage
1. Install this app.
2. Open swagger page in GitHub.
- Try: <https://github.com/OAI/OpenAPI-Specification/blob/main/examples/v3.0/petstore.yaml>
3. Click this app icon.
4. Have a good development!
## ChangeLog
https://github.com/arx-6/swagger-viewer/blob/main/CHANGELOG.md
Latest reviews
- (2022-11-22) Akshay Bhore: It does not format the yaml file from local machine. Only works with github pages.
- (2022-09-06) Benson Chen: Really amazing chrome extension!! Hope it will support github enterprise in the future as well!
- (2022-02-16) Владислав Воронин: Doesn't follow refs, thus useless
- (2022-02-03) Andrew Stanton: A "swagger viewer" should not be restricted to only GitHub pages. Especially one that says it works offline; I should be able to load a swagger/openapi json file in the browser from a website or local disk and with this tool I would expect it to make a swagger UI from it. This does not do that.
- (2021-01-27) YM: Thanks for a great extension! Very useful ❤️
- (2019-10-15) Alexander Taylor Ruef: Quick and easy
- (2019-10-04) It works and it is great!
- (2019-08-29) Atila The son of Danubius: Couldn't read anything!